At the heart of The Rock's staggering financial empire lies the concept of scarcity. In an industry where talent is often a dime a dozen, he has positioned himself as a rare and premium commodity. His movie career, which began with supporting roles in films like "The Mummy Returns," quickly escalated to A-list dominance with the "Jumanji" franchise and the fast-paced fury of "Furious 7." He is the actor studios greenlight without hesitation because his presence is a guarantee. He is the opening weekend bulletproof. This consistent box office reliability grants him an unprecedented level of negotiating power. Reports suggest he has commanded upfront fees in the tens of millions, a figure that only accounts for the base salary. He often secures backend points, meaning he earns a percentage of the film's gross revenue. For a global blockbuster, this percentage can translate into a payday that dwarfs his initial fee, turning a single movie appearance into a transaction worth a hundred million dollars.
The foundation of any major celebrity's wealth in 2021 remained their core talent, but the avenues for monetizing that talent had evolved dramatically. For actors, the traditional studio deal was no longer the sole pinnacle; the streaming wars, epitomized by the launch of HBO Max and the continued expansion of Disney+, created a landscape where exclusive content deals became king. Leading names commanded unprecedented sums to attach themselves to a series or film, a direct reflection of their drawing power in a competitive market. Musicians, too, found new life not just in album sales and touring—both heavily impacted by the pandemic—but in the resurgence of live events as the world yearned for connection. Yet, perhaps the most significant shift was the aggressive encroachment of brand partnerships and entrepreneurial ventures. Celebrities transformed from mere endorsers to active stakeholders, launching their own fashion lines, beauty empires, and media production companies. This move towards entrepreneurship allowed them to retain a greater share of the profit, turning their personal influence into sustainable, long-term business assets rather than one-off promotional fees.

J. K. Rowling, the British author who brought the wizarding world of Harry Potter to life, is one of the most successful and influential writers in modern history. Her journey from a single mother on welfare to a global literary icon is a story of immense talent, perseverance, and, inevitably, staggering financial success. Understanding J. K. Rowling's net worth requires delving into the mechanics of the Potter empire, the sheer scale of its consumption, and the shrewd business decisions that transformed a series of children’s books into a multibillion-dollar franchise. As of the latest estimates, her net worth consistently ranks among the highest for authors globally, comfortably sitting above the $1 billion mark, making her one of the wealthiest people in the entertainment industry.
